[Remote] Director, Strategic Deal Finance
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Liftoff Mobile is a leading AI-powered performance marketing platform for the mobile app economy. They are seeking a Director to lead Deal Desk within the Strategic Finance team, responsible for managing commercial agreements and ensuring financial integrity in deal structures.
Responsibilities
- Serve as DRI for all revenue adjustments in weekly reporting: own the underlying logic, file integrity, and formula soundness
- Maintain active reconciliation checks and ensure adjustments are accurate, complete, and explainable at any point in the week
- Work proactively with cross-functional partners throughout the week to incorporate new intel before weekly close
- Lead weekly alignment meetings with the FP&A team; own WoW variance explanation and post summaries to relevant stakeholders
- Own all deal types end-to-end ranging from standard structures to complex, unique, and customer-specific arrangements
- Maintain and enforce the Deal Desk approval matrix; lead a bi-annual Deal Desk Strategy Review with SLT
- Own the philosophy and commercial logic underlying how Liftoff approaches deal structures, including eligibility thresholds and deal parameters by customer segment
- For non-standard deals: lead upfront diligence including detailed financial modeling
- Lead weekly cross-functional reviews on active non-standard deals; make budget and commercial adjustment recommendations as needed
- Produce monthly performance updates on active deal programs for senior leadership, with clear variance analysis against original assumptions
- Monitor cash flows and financial commitments on structured deals; update models as actuals come in and flag deviations proactively
- Own and lead accrual review for all key Deal Desk items, including complex arrangements
- Hold a well-supported, defensible position on accrual levels, with the underlying data and logic ready to present in senior Finance forums
- This role includes direct management of a Senior Analyst, with responsibility for mentorship, prioritization, and maintaining high analytical standards across Deal Desk operations
